2022 (SENIOR): Two-time CCAA Player of the Week, for weeks of April 4-10 and May 2-8 ... Finished season on reached-base streak of 26 games ... RBI double in fifth inning of season finale at NCAA West Region #1 sub-regional at No. 3 Point Loma (5/19) gave him exactly 100 RBI for CPP career ... Produced fourth-longest hit streak in program history of 22 games late in year ... Elite 13 Award recipient at CCAA Baseball Tournament as student-athlete with highest cumulative GPA participating in championship.

2021: No season due to COVID-19 pandemic.

2020 (SENIOR):  One of five Broncos to appear in all 21 games during shortened campaign, and one of just three to earn start in each, all at second base ... Hit better than .300 for second year in a row at CPP, at .333 (32-96) ... Contributed 21 runs, six doubles, two home runs, 12 RBI, two walks and four hit-by-pitches ... Slugged .458 with .369 on-base percentage for .827 OPS ... Paced team in hits, at-bats, runs, doubles (tied) and HBPs (tied), second in home runs and RBI, and third in batting and OPS ... Led CCAA in at-bats, tied for fourth in hits (35th nationally), tied for sixth in doubles, tied for eighth in runs, tied for ninth in total bases (44), and 11th in toughest to strike out (9.6) ... Provided two-out, two-run, opposite-field, walk-off single through left side to cap 12-inning triumph vs. UC-Colorado Springs (2/7) on Opening Day, finishing 2-for-6 with sac fly, run and game-high four RBI ... Went 2-for-4 with game-winning run vs. UCCS (2/8) ... Wound up 7-for-19 (.368) with walk, RBI and four runs in series split vs. No. 2 UC San Diego (2/14-16) ... Was 2-for-5 and scored walk-off winner on wild pitch as CPP struck twice in ninth for 2-1 victory vs. Cal State LA (2/21) ... Went 4-for-6 with three-run home run and season bests of four hits, two doubles, four runs and four RBI (tied) in romp at Cal State LA (2/23) ... Was 3-for-6 with double, two runs and lone steal of season at Cal State San Bernardino (2/29) ... Went 2-for-5 with double and three runs in win at San Francisco State (3/7) ... Produced 11 multi-hit games, pair of four-RBI efforts, and 11-game hit streak from Feb. 8-26 ... Had a hit in 18 of 21 contests ... Did not commit an error in 91 defensive chances (39-52-0), and aided in 15 double plays.

2019 (JUNIOR):  Started all 57 games played, only missing series finale vs. No. 20 San Francisco State (3/17) ... Batted team-best .337 (68-202) with 34 runs, 15 doubles, four home runs, 41 RBI, 23 walks, 12 hit-by-pitches, four sacrifice flies, seven sacrifice hits, and 12 steals on 16 attempts ... Slugged .470 with .427 on-base percentage for .897 OPS ... Paced CPP in hits, RBI, steals, hit-by-pitches and sac flies, tied for lead in sac bunts, and third in at-bats, runs, doubles, total bases (95) and walks ... Tied for third in CCAA in hit-by-pitches, tied for fifth in sac bunts, sixth in steals, tied for seventh in doubles, tied for ninth in hits, and tied for 10th in sac flies ... Began Bronco career with a bang, going 4-for-5 with a walk, two runs, two RBI and season highs of four hits and three doubles as starting second baseman in opening win at UC-Colorado Springs (2/1), with initial plate appearance in green and gold resulting in two-out, opposite-field RBI double to left center to cap three-run first ... Went 2-for-4 in series finale at UCCS (2/3) with a double, run, two RBI and first long ball as a Bronco ... Was 3-for-4 with hit-by-pitch, home run, steal, two RBI and season-high four runs as CPP completed four-game sweep at Cal State Dominguez Hills (2/17) ... Posted trio of three-hit games against Toros, going 10-for-16 (.625) on weekend with seven runs, six RBI, two doubles, one home run, three steals on four tries, four hit-by-pitches and just two strikeouts ... Was 2-for-4 with two runs and season-best four RBI vs. Cal State San Bernardino (3/8), his fifth-inning grand slam turning 3-1 deficit into 5-3 Bronco triumph ... Finished 3-for-6 with home run, two runs and three RBI in series-opening victory at Cal State Monterey Bay (4/5) ... Was 3-for-3 with walk, two doubles, two runs and steal at Chico State (4/18) ... Had 22 multi-hit and nine multi-RBI efforts ... Pair of nine-game hit streaks, from Feb. 9-23 and March 15-30 ... Fielded .951 (90-124-11) and was part of 35 double plays.

2018 (SOPHOMORE at MT. SAC):  All-South Coast Conference North Second Team ... Appeared in 43 games ... Batted stellar .351 (60-171) and slugged .450 with 36 runs, 13 doubles, two triples, 27 RBI, 25 walks, seven hit-by-pitches, a .447 on-base percentage and 11 steals ... Aided Mounties to 35-14 overall record and first place in SCC North with 17-5 league mark ... Mt. SAC went 6-1 through three rounds of CCCAA Southern California Regionals before losing both games at state championship in Fresno ... Fielded .970 (162-93-8) and had a hand in 28 double plays ... Played with former CPP teammate Steven Ordorica ... Student of Distinction Scholarship Award.

2017 (FRESHMAN at MT. SAC):  Appeared in 39 games, batting .289 (43-149) with 33 runs, two doubles, one triple, 13 RBI, 19 walks, nine hit-by-pitches, a .399 on-base percentage and 12 steals ... Fielded .904 (46-104-16) and was part of 11 double plays.

HIGH SCHOOL:  A 2016 graduate of Santiago High School in Corona, Calif. ... All-Big VIII First Team as a senior and second team as a junior for Sharks ... Four-year recipient of Student-Athlete Award ... Graduated with honors.

PERSONAL:  Currently attending CPP as a graduate student, working on a Master's Degree in Business Administration ... Earned his Bachelor's Degree in Sociology ... Born Sept. 24 in Riverside, Calif. ... Son of parents Richard and Rebecca ... Has an older sister, Rachel ... Aspires to work in logistics or management ... Enjoys working out or playing video games ... Roots for the Los Angeles Dodgers ... Favorite athlete is Justin Turner ... Favorite TV show is The Mandalorian ... Top movie is Talladega Nights: The Ballad of Ricky Bobby ... Loves Chipotle ... Also attended California Baptist University in Riverside, Calif.
